Output e0652f2f73035e18842c1db43eeb0de849141cd5d204279fedb9888bc16eed3e:0

value
6981087581429
script pubkey
OP_0 OP_PUSHBYTES_20 9877dbd66ade6d665284777c79882ca630e8ee88
address
tb1qnpmah4n2mekkv55ywa78nzpv5ccw3m5g74dfjq
transaction
e0652f2f73035e18842c1db43eeb0de849141cd5d204279fedb9888bc16eed3e
confirmations
164676
spent
true